About CCBO
|
CCBO is committed to providing educational and professional support, networking opportunities, and timely trend and demographic information for business officers representing community colleges and community college system offices in the US and in Canada. The association works to help business officers better prepare for successful professional roles in the business and service enterprise of the community college. CCBO recognizes that excellence in the profession sets the standard for the future and strives to acknowledge those professionals who have excelled in the field. |

The Board of Directors of the Community College Business Officers executed significant organizational changes in 2009. After a thorough discussion, these changes were unanimously approved by the Board of Directors at the September 2009 meeting, as were the resulting Bylaw revisions necessary to implement the proposed new organization structure. Mission
CCBO provides educational and professional support, networking opportunities, and other resources to help current and future business officers and other professionals better prepare for successful roles in the business, administrative, and service enterprises of community colleges in the United States and Canada.
* * *
CCBO Core Values
- Networking and Community – CCBO is committed to representing the business operations of community colleges that support educating students and to working collaboratively with its internal and external constituents.
- Quality and Excellence - CCBO recognizes that excellence in the profession leads to superior community college business operations and services. Additionally, CCBO recognizes outstanding professionals and exemplary practices.
- Volunteerism and Leadership - CCBO values the volunteer contributions of its members and partners and commits to the development of leadership skills among current and future business officers and other professionals.
- Fiscal Responsibility and Integrity – CCBO recognizes that fiscal responsibility requires ethical personal and professional conduct and appropriate use of resources and promotes these values.
- Sustainability – CCBO commits to diversity, social and environmental responsibility, cultural competence, and global awareness.
